Technically Flying Press already exists
>>31493803
And triple-typed pokemon are already technically possible for the grass and ghost types (albeit if just temporarily), thanks to forest curse and trickortreat.
I wouldn't be surprised if they make more moves like flying press or actual triple types in the future.
